"This summery Glisan cocktail bar is best known for its piña coladas, served in hollowed-out pineapples on its outdoor patio; however, the bar always offers a handful of distinct margaritas ideal for those intimidated by a giant, booze-filled fruit. The spicy mango margarita pairs reposado with the sweet heat of habanero-mango syrup, finished with a Tajín rim. When available, the seasonal Oregon strawberry margarita is an essential order." - Alex Frane, Eater Staff

"For the folks looking specifically for frozen piña coladas, look no further than Tropicale. Founded by the late Alfredo Climaco, known as the “Piña Colada King” of Portland, Tropicale’s flagship cocktail is his famous piña colada, which can be ordered and served inside a hollowed-out pineapple. The piña coladas are also available without alcohol or in smaller sizes, for those unprepared to drink a pineapple’s worth of booze. The bar is serving customers on a lively shared patio." - Michelle Lopez, Brooke Jackson-Glidden
